Dynamic dialysis is an exciting new technology that utilizes fluid dynamics to increase purification efficiency and improve large buffer handling, ideal for the production of fragile proteins, viscous fluids and polymer gels, such as hyaluronic acid. These closed, high-efficiency systems offer high concentration gradient dialysis without manual buffer changes and in-process sample handling.

Dynamic dialysis is ideal for the purification of viscous fluids and hydrogels (hyaluronic acid – HA) that cannot be filtered. Where traditional filtration methods may fail, dynamic dialysis uses flow dynamics to increase both the rate and efficiency of dialysis.
